Understanding the Causes of Tension Concerning Self-Perception:
Conflict concerning body image frequently originates from a deep-seated societal pressure to fit into unattainable standards of attractiveness. These ideals, often perpetuated by the media, advertisements, and networking sites, can result in:
Internalized Self-Criticism: Persons, specifically women, may ingrain these norms, contributing to self-criticism, dissatisfaction with their bodies, and even disordered eating patterns.
Comparison and Competition: Constant contact with flawless pictures can encourage a atmosphere of competition, causing sensations of inferiority and low self-esteem.
Objectification and Sexualization: The stress on physical attributes, specifically in the instance of breasts, can lead to the objectification and sensualization of females, reducing them to their outer appearance.
These societal pressures can generate tension within connections, contributing to:
Communication Breakdowns: Trouble in communicating concerns about self-perception or cultural influences without feeling criticized or ignored.
Strained Relationships: Resentment and disagreement can occur when couples possess varying opinions on self-perception or have disparate encounters with cultural influences.
Psychological Distress: Persons may undergo unease, sadness, or other psychological difficulties due to the constant pressure to conform to unrealistic ideals of beauty.
Preparing for Difficult Conversations About Physical Appearance:
Before commencing a conversation about physical appearance, it's crucial to:
Generate a Safe and Supportive Environment: Pick a time and setting where you and your partner experience relaxed and safe to convey your opinions and feelings without dread of criticism or reproach.
Reflect on Your Own Self-Perception: Comprehend your own association with your physical form and how societal pressures have affected you.
Center on Empathy and Understanding: Approach the conversation with compassion and a genuine desire to comprehend your companion's point of view.
Define Clear Boundaries: Define clear limits for the discussion, making sure that both sides experience respected and heard.
Effective Communication Strategies:
Active Listening: Focus intently on what your significant other is communicating, both verbally and through actions. Validate their emotions and validate their encounters, even if you don't hold the same perspective.
"I" Statements: Express your own sentiments and encounters using "statements from your perspective, such as "It concerns me when..." or "I'm afraid that..." This stops blaming or charging your companion.
Challenge Societal Norms Together: Participate in open and honest discussions about the unattainable standards of attractiveness perpetuated by media and society. Challenge these norms together and examine other outlooks.
Center on Wellness: Shift the attention from physical appearance to overall health and well-being. Support beneficial routines, for example working out, nutrition, self-perception in relationships and self-care, that encourage both bodily and emotional health.
Find Assistance: In the event that you or your companion are struggling with concerns about physical appearance, contemplate looking for help from a psychologist who specializes in body image concerns.
